Abstract: The method is for treating a liquid or slurry with an ultrasonic energy. A movable endless member is provided that is permeable to a liquid. A transverse foil is disposed below the member and extends across the member and a transducer is in operative engagement with the foil. The member is moved about rollers. The transducer generates pressure pulses into the foil to form implosion bubbles in the liquid disposed above the member. The implosion bubbles have a first diameter (d1). A gap is formed between the member and the foil. The gap represents a distance (d2) that is less than the diameter (d1) of the bubbles to prevent any bubbles of critical size to be captured in the gap.

Abstract: The method is for testing an electrical component. The sender unit 12 may be applied to an electrical plug 24 that has a first line 28, a second line 32 and a ground line 36. It is determined which of the lines 28, 32, 36 that has a voltage potential relative to the surrounding. The phase configuration of the electrical plug 24 may be determined. The unit 14 is applied to a remote electrical unit and the sender sends a synchronization signal 41 to the receiver unit 14 that starts a counter providing a measurement of the time difference between corresponding phase positions of the alternating current of the plug 24 and that of the remote electrical unit. This time difference can then be converted to a phase difference value. The system may also be used to identify a specific fuse that is associated with the plug and for testing ground fault interrupting devices.

Abstract: The method is for selecting a telephone operator for mobile telephones. The mobile telephone has an operator card installed therein that has preprogrammed codes for providing communication via a first and a second telephone operator. A telephone number is then entered on the mobile telephone to activate the mobile telephone. A first request signal is sent to the first telephone operator and a second request signal is sent to the second telephone operator. The first telephone operator sends back a first response signal to the mobile telephone and the second telephone operator sends back a second response signal to the mobile telephone. A price request signal is sent to the first and second telephone operators. In response to the price request signal, the first telephone operator sends back a first price signal and the second telephone operator sends back a second price signal to the mobile telephone.

Abstract: The system is for the oxygen delignification, in at least two reaction stages, of pulp that consists of lignocellulose-containing material having a mean concentration of 8%-18% pulp consistency. The oxygen delignification takes place in a first reaction stage that has a substantially constant low pressure during the whole delignification process. The second delignification stage has a substantially higher pressure and temperature and a longer dwell time. Readily delignifiable constituents in the pulp may react without the pulp being negatively affected so that the delignification process provides a very high degree of selectivity and an improved yield.

Abstract: The apparatus and method for processing worms uses spaced top and bottom surfaces of a rotor set a sufficient distance apart so that worm bodies to be processed touch both surfaces. A splitter is located mid-way between the surfaces and the worm bodies are forced by centrifugal force and by a flow of water in which the bodies are entrained to encounter and to be split by the splitter blade. The top and bottom surfaces are set a sufficient distance apart so that the worm bodies are partially flattened when passing therebetween. The splitter is located so as to be operative to split the central digestive tract of the worm body. An inlet is located in the top surface through which the worm bodies are introduced into the space between the top and bottom surfaces.
Abstract: The pipe system is for receiving and transporting lime sludge from a filter medium in a continuously operating pressurized filter 1 in a causticizing process, where lime sludge is scraped off from the filter medium 2 and falls down into receiving chutes 4a for the lime sludge. Conventional storage tanks for scraped-off lime sludge and their mechanical agitators are thus replaced by a pipe system 11 where the pipe system does not have a mechanical agitator at all but has a flow cross section which maintains a flow rate in the lime sludge so that sedimentation of the lime sludge does not take place from the receiving chute 4a to the feed-out opening 30 of the pipe system.
Abstract: The invention relates to a method for the determination of stand attributes with an instrument above the stand. In the method, three-dimensional information is collected from the stands by using such a number of sample hits, that individual trees or groups of trees can be distinguished. A three-dimensional tree height model is produced from collected information. Stand attributes—which are characteristics of individual trees or groups of trees and/or characteristics derived using these information for larger areas—are determined from the tree height model. The invention also relates to a computer program which can be used to carry out the second and third step of the method.

Abstract: The valve (1) has a valve casing (2), a cone (4) with a shaft (40) emanating from the Cone (4), and a seat (20). The valve has a control element (3) for moving the cone (4) to and from the seat (20). The control element (3) comprises a first leg (30) located outside the valve casing (2) and a second leg (31) which is at least partially located inside the valve casing (2). The second leg (31) passes through and is firmly attached to an elastic and springing-back wall section (21) on the valve casing (2) which faces the seat (20) and its lower end (310) merges into the shaft (40) via a joint (5). When the valve is closed the springing-back wall section (21) presses the cone (4) against the seat (20) via the second leg (31) and the shaft (40).

Abstract: The packet processor system has a port for receiving packets from a first network. A line interface unit is connected to the port for determining the types of packets that are received by the port. A generic pipeline stage assembly is connected to the line interface unit and includes a plurality of generic pipeline stages each having a request engine for sending lookup requests to a lookup engine and a modifier engine for receiving lookup results from the lookup engine. A packet memory is connected to a last generic pipeline stage of the generic pipeline stage assembly and an output line interface unit is connected to the packet memory and a second network.

Abstract: The invention is concerned with a method for the determination of the charging state of filtrates of fiber masses used in the manufacturing of paper and cardboard. In the method, a sample is filtrated from fibers through a filter, and indicator color is added to the filtrate. The absorbance of the filtrate is measured and the charging state of the solution is read from an earlier made calibration curve that corresponds to the measured absorbance.
